User Intent Focus
It is all about intent when it comes to the difference between AEO and SEO. SEO uses keywords a lot to match queries, whereas AEO takes in more context of the question a user has. AEO makes the answer explicit,
crisp, and conversational, which is more in line with what the searchers really desire.
Search Format Adaptation
The format of search results is one of the most significant changes in the comparison of Answer Engine Optimization vs Traditional SEO. SEO is geared towards search engine page rankings,
whereas AEO is geared towards immediate, verbal, or generated answers. That is why AEO is essential in a world where AI-powered assistants and voice searches have become the norm.

Keyword Dependence
In Traditional SEO techniques vs AEO, the place of keywords is very different. SEO is based on organised keywords and long-tail variations to rank. AEO goes further than keywords, though, and it understands
natural language to produce the exact answers. This renders AEO less reliant on using keywords and more on clarity.

Content Depth
Depth is important in Answer Engine Optimization vs Traditional SEO. To grab a greater number of keywords, SEO frequently focuses on long-form content. AEO favours structured, brief,
and precise content blocks that can be copied out by AI engines. Such transformation requires greater accuracy and information organisation.
Technical Optimization
In the case of Traditional SEO methods versus AEO, the technical aspect alters, too. SEO is concerned with the backlinks, site speed, and metadata. AEO needs schema markup, frequently asked questions,
and easy-to-follow structures to enable AI to be able to easily access content. These modifications make sure that answers are provided fast and well.
